Download Sample Ask For Discount Japan 5G Optical Transceiver Cooling Market By Type Segment Analysis The Japan 5G optical transceiver cooling market is primarily segmented based on cooling technology types, including air cooling, liquid cooling, and hybrid cooling solutions. Among these, liquid cooling is gaining significant traction due to its superior thermal management capabilities, especially in high-density 5G infrastructure environments. Air cooling remains prevalent in lower-capacity deployments, offering cost-effective and straightforward solutions suitable for initial network rollouts. Hybrid cooling combines both methods to optimize performance and energy efficiency, catering to evolving data center and telecom infrastructure demands. The market size by type is estimated at approximately USD 150 million in 2023, with liquid cooling accounting for around 50% of the segment, driven by the increasing deployment of high-capacity 5G transceivers requiring advanced thermal management. The air cooling segment is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7% over the next five years, while liquid cooling is expected to expand at a faster CAGR of approximately 12%, reflecting its adoption in high-performance applications. Japan 5G Optical Transceiver Cooling Market By Application Segment Analysis The application landscape for 5G optical transceiver cooling in Japan encompasses telecommunications infrastructure, data centers, enterprise networks, and emerging IoT and edge computing deployments. Telecommunications infrastructure remains the largest application segment, accounting for approximately 60% of the total market in 2023, driven by nationwide 5G rollout initiatives and the need for reliable, high-capacity transceivers. Data centers are the second-largest segment, experiencing rapid growth due to the surge in data traffic, cloud computing, and digital transformation initiatives. The application of advanced cooling solutions in data centers is crucial to maintain operational efficiency and prevent thermal bottlenecks. The market size for application-specific cooling solutions is estimated at USD 180 million in 2023, with telecommunications leading at an estimated USD 108 million, followed by data centers at USD 54 million. The fastest-growing application segment is edge computing, projected to grow at a CAGR of 15% over the next five years, as Japan accelerates deployment of localized 5G services and IoT applications requiring compact, high-performance transceivers with efficient cooling systems.
